Key Performance Area:
Receive / IBT Stock
  • Ensure always a 2nd designated Cashbuild Employee present with receiving and / or dispatching of stock
  • Receive stock from Suppliers, correctly identify goods and physically balance to the Suppliers Invoice / Delivery Note and Cashbuild’s purchase order.
  • Complete proof of delivery note and hand to Supplier with required stamps.
  • Capture correctly on the IT system within prescribed time limits.
  • Ensure all invoices with discrepancies have been amended, endorsed, and signed off by the Supplier’s representative as well as registration number of truck entered onto invoice.
  • Ensure all inter branch transfers (IBT’S) IN and OUT are processed within the set time period and that there are no discrepancies, and all relevant documentation is filed.
Stock Distribution
  • Stock received must be cleared from the GRS office and merchandised within prescribed time limits of receiving the stock
Stock Labelling and Pricing
  • Ensure all stock received without the SKU printed on the packaging is labelled with the appropriate SKU on the back of the product.
  • Ensure that items with printed SKU's are correct and rectify any errors noted.
  • Adherence to Cashbuild pricing policy
  • Pending price changes to be actioned as per the Cashbuild Way
Supplier Claims and Corrections
  • Ensure that all claims are validated with the Suppliers pick up slips or credit notes attached to the adjustment vouchers and authorised by the Store Manager.
  • Ensure any corrections done have the required documentation attached and authorised by the Store Manager
  • Supplier claims should not be raised unless stock is to be collected immediately.
Security Awareness
  • Receiving gate not to be left unattended when opened
  • Receiving stamp and Purchase Order delivery book must be locked in a lockable cupboard or drawer
  • The GRS office door must always be locked when the GRS office is not in use
  • Ensure the supplier truck crews do not loiter around the Store but remain at their trucks.
